WFP provides logistic support to Red Crescent

Damascus, SANA – The World Food Programme (WFP) provided 15 trucks, 2 SUVs, 23 protective vests, and a number of helmets to the Syrian Arab Red Crescent (SARC) to help the organization’s volunteers and workers to carry out their humanitarian tasks.

While receiving the items, head of the SARC Abdelrahman al-Attar thanked the WFP for its constant support for the organization, saying that this support will help ensure that SARC staff will continue their work and access everyone affected by the crisis.

In turn, WFP representative in Syria Matthew Hollingworth asserted the strength of the relations between the two organizations, saying that the “courage and dedication of SARC volunteers cannot be taken lightly.”

This is the second instance of the WFP providing support logistic to the SARC, with 20 trucks provided to the Red Crescent by the Programme last year.

The overall support provided by the WFP to the SARC is estimated at USD 4 million.
